About Mohd Zulkefeli

Mohd Zulkefeli is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Geriatrics and Gerontology and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ology, having authored 30 papers that have together received 601 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Supramolecular Chemistry and Complexes (8 papers), Molecular Sensors and Ion Detection (7 papers) and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Organic Chemistry (279 citations), Spectroscopy (98 citations) and Biochemistry (27 citations). Mohd Zulkefeli has collaborated with scholars based in Malaysia, Japan and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Shin Aoki, Eiichi Kimura, Motoo Shiro, M. Sirajul Islam, Md. Tanvir Islam, Selina Akter, Chun‐Wai Mai, Kei Takeda, May Lee Low and Lik Voon Kiew. Their work appears in journ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of the American Chemical Society and International Journal of Molecular Sciences.
